Molly Swank Tapped To Lead Common Cause New Mexico

Molly Swank was named executive director of Common Cause New Mexico (CCNM) Jan. 1. CCNM is a non-partisan voting rights group dedicated to upholding the core values of American democracy — equal access to the ballot and open, honest and accountable government.

Swank has a wealth of experience in community organizing and non-profit management. She served as community engagement director for Planned Parenthood of the Rocky Mountains, directing field operations and electoral campaigns in a four-state area, including New Mexico. Previously she served as legislative and advocacy associate for Planned Parenthood in Wisconsin, where she spent most of her life.

Since arriving in New Mexico in 2020, she has worked as a campaign and programs director for the Center for Civic Policy and as a field education coordinator for the Master’s in Social Work program at Highlands University.

She is a graduate of Emerge Wisconsin and several Wellstone training programs, where she was trained in volunteer engagement and voter mobilization.

“My purpose has always been to ensure that every individual has the tools they need to be civically engaged and to advocate for the policies that will make for thriving communities,” Swank said. “I come from the community side of advocacy work, not the policy side, so I’m hoping to bring the voices of our communities to the forefront of Common Cause’s work, and this year she will be focusing on Common Cause’s drive to modernize the New Mexico legislature, as well as ensuring equal access to the ballot during upcoming elections.”

Swank holds a Master of Social Work from the University of Wisconsin – Milwaukee and a dual Bachelor of Arts in Sociology and Women’s Studies from the University of Wisconsin – Madison.
